Brett Maxwell |
 |
Class:
Senior |
Hometown:
Spring Green, WI |
Position:
Defensive End |
2003: Ranked second on team in tackles and started every game,
making at least four tackles in each contest...Shared WIAC lead with
three forced fumbles, earning honorable mention All-WIAC accolades...Had
career-high 13 tackles, including 10 solo stops, against
UW-Oshkosh...Forced two fumbles and posted nine tackles at
Tri-State...Had seven tackles, including three for loss and a sack at
Augustana...Added seven tackles in wins over Butler and UW-River
Falls...Also forced and recovered a fumble against Butler. 2002:
Started every game at linebacker, totaling at least three tackles in
every game...Only interception of season was timely, stopping
UW-Platteville�s overtime possession in a 34-28 win...Ranked second on
team with 78 tackles and had nine tackles for loss in seven different
games...Totaled season-high 12 tackles against UW-Stout and 11 stops
against UW-La Crosse...Had 10 tackles, including eight solo stops and a
fumble recovery, at UW-River Falls...Had nine tackles and a fumble
recovery against UW-Eau Claire.
